We are looking for a Transport Planner to join our team on our City Plumbing Supplies contract in Warrington. Working within a team of two, you will be driving efficiency and reducing cost while delivering excellent service to our customer. You\'ll be responsible for route planning, along with developing and managing real relationships with customers and drivers. You\'ll ensure that our transport department always runs in an efficient and effective manner. You\'ll work on a Monday - Friday basis, 10:00 - 18:00, however, some flexibility is required.
